What Does onom vs npm Mean?

So If you're jogging Yarn, do thinking about attempting them out! Likelihood is they'll greatly improve your put in times.

To view vulnerable offers in the Problems Device window, click on while in the inspection widget. The File tab of the issues Instrument window lists each of the vulnerable offers which are detected in the current file. Every product is provided with an outline.

FrontendWeb can be a System for writers and readers to examine and write a different post about frontend developers, comprehensive-stack builders, World-wide-web builders, and Computer system science. It can be an open-resource community that be part of and gathers frontend developers to construct and share knowledge with Many others

pnpm init We’ll make a very simple code file for bundle a using an exported perform, a thing that we can contact through the root offer:

It doesn’t run it on offers that don’t employ it, such as validation package deal, which isn’t a startable bundle, so it doesn’t will need that script.

The npm Software window opens when you choose a package.json file within the Challenge Software window or open it inside the editor and choose Show npm Scripts from the context menu.

Due to the fact these worries are still in drive at the time of writing, I are convinced Yarn is preferable in terms of safety.

Sad to say, should you’re going from Yarn/npm to pnpm, some packages might not work. More often than not, This can be a result of missing dependencies from the package’s package.json file.

I grew to become really discouraged working with npm. It gave the impression to be acquiring slower and slower. Dealing with A lot more code repos meant carrying out more Regular npm installs. I used a great deal of time sitting and looking forward to it to complete and pondering, there need to be a much better way!

, which is a good next action for the monorepo when it’s developed also massive and sophisticated — or, for example, you ought to break up it up and also have different CI/CD pipelines for each project.

I’m sparing you the screenshots for a great motive - I did mention we happen to be making use of Yarn two in that monorepo for some time. We’ve also been incorporating countless packages in numerous workspaces that we ended up with plenty of duplicated dependencies, ie with several versions of exactly the same packages.

It may also create a package-lock.json file. This file is employed to explain the tree of dependecies that was produced.

See what comes about for those who enter no text and click on Increase todo item. Trying to add an vacant click here to-do product to the record shows an inform during the browser; the validation library in the frontend has prevented you from adding an invalid to-do product.

Now we can see this folder is actually linking to a different folder in node_modules​/.pnpm: This is certainly pnpm’s Virtual Shop

Leave a Reply

Your email address will not be published. Required fields are marked *